Contract HSCG4109PQW2433
Vane Brothers Marine Safety & Services, Inc · Department Of Homeland Security · March 3, 2009
Vane Brothers Marine Safety & Services, Inc was awarded a federal contract by Department Of Homeland Security (U.S. Coast Guard) on March 3, 2009 for $8,000 of work in various services. Performance is in Yorktown, VA. It was awarded under full and open competition. The contract has been modified 1 time since the base award It uses firm fixed-price contract pricing. The most recent modification was on April 27, 2009.
